John Charles Bedini
Electrical Engineer, Inventor
July 13th, 1949 - November 5th, 2016 The talents are different. He could "compose on the fly."
Some people play the piano by music, others play by ear, and some can do both. John Bedini had a natural ability with electronics. He did not work from a circuit diagram, though he knew how to read them and compose them. For him, the positioning and balancing of components comes as naturally as one who is gifted at playing the piano by ear. He had a natural feel for what diodes to use with what ca
pacitors and transistors and transformers; what they do, and how they interact. He worked with these building blocks, even making the from scratch for years. His original and persisting fame came in the world of audio equipment. His Bedini sound systems are still used in the professional recording industry. Three-D sound, the ability to convey high fidelity on junk wires, digital sound with the quality of analogue, and more. John Charles Bedini, 67, passed away unexpectedly on November 5th, 2016. He was born in Glendale, California., on July 13th, 1949, to Rosalee and Alex Bedini. He moved to the Coeur d’Alene area in August 1990 and was presently living in Hayden. He was a proud member of the Hayden Lake Eagles where he served as Trustee. He loved cooking for various events held at the Eagles Lodge. His favorite pastime was working on and driving his hot rods and motorcycles. He and his brother, Gary, ran electronics manufacturing businesses for more than 40 years. John had a natural talent for designing electronic circuits. Many times he would wake up from a dream and sketch the circuit down on any kind of paper he could find around the house. Most recently his talents were being used in the design and manufacturing battery chargers and solar tracking devices for use in home solar power units. PATENTS
2006 Sep 19 - USP7109671 - Device and method of a back EMF permanent electromagnetic motor generator
2004 Jan 13 - USP6677730 - Device and method for pulse charging a battery and for driving other devices with a pulse
2003 Apr 08 - USP6545444 - Device and method for utilizing a monopole motor to create back EMF to charge batteries
2002 May 21 - USP6392370 - Device and method of a back EMF permanent electromagnetic motor generator
1998 May 05 - USP5748745 - Analog vector processor and method for producing a binaural signal
1996 Jan 23 - USP5487057 - Apparatus and method for reducing electronic relaxation noise present information recording medium
1987 Feb 17 - USP5464442 - Anti-copy system
1985 Nov 26 - USP4555795 - Monaural to binaural audio processor
